Step-by-Step Guide to Enable SSH
Enabling SSH on your Raspberry Pi is a simple process. Follow these steps to activate it:
- Open the Raspberry Pi configuration tool by running
sudo raspi-config
in the terminal. - Navigate to “Interfacing Options” and select “SSH.”
- Choose “Yes” to enable SSH and exit the configuration tool.
Verifying SSH Access
Once SSH is enabled, you can verify it by connecting to your Raspberry Pi from another device using an SSH client like PuTTY or Terminal.

Security Tips for Remote Access
While RemoteIoT ensures secure connections, it’s important to follow best practices for remote access. Here are some tips:
- Use strong, unique passwords for your Raspberry Pi and RemoteIoT account.
- Enable two-factor authentication (2FA) for added security.
- Regularly update your Raspberry Pi’s operating system and software.
Common Security Mistakes
Avoid using default credentials and ensure your firewall settings are properly configured to prevent unauthorized access.
